Chainalysis reports x402 protocol surpasses 100 million agentic transactions on Base

Third-party on-chain data from Chainalysis validates real transaction volume on x402, though growth was partly driven by meme coin farming (PING) rather than pure AI-agent utility — a useful signal with caveats on quality of volume.
